Total Cost of Buying a Property

Based on standard Maharashtra stamp duty and registration rates. These can vary by municipal corporation, gender-based concessions, and government revisions — always confirm the exact figure with your sub-registrar office before transacting.

Stamp Duty₹7.80 Lakh
Registration Fee₹30,000
Approx. Total Extra Cost₹8.10 Lakh

Note: Maharashtra stamp duty is charged on whichever is higher — the actual agreement value or the government Ready Reckoner value (about ₹12,000/sq.ft built-up in Kolshet Road, on an estimated basis).

Unlike every other rate on this page, the Ready Reckoner is calculated on built-up area, not carpet area — Maharashtra’s own formula treats built-up area as carpet area × 1.20.

You can verify the current official Ready Reckoner rate and calculate exact stamp duty on the Maharashtra IGR government portal.

About Kolshet Road

Kolshet Road runs from the Ghodbunder Road side down towards the Thane creek and Balkum, and has become one of Thane’s fastest-growing residential belts — large branded projects from Lodha, Godrej, Runwal and Piramal along a road that is itself being widened.

At around ₹20,000/sq.ft asking, Kolshet Road is up about 13.7% over the last year (99acres), one of the stronger moves in Thane. Portals show an ₹18,000–22,000/sq.ft working band. Registered deals average lower, near ₹16,500.

What is the current property rate in Kolshet Road?

The average asking rate in Kolshet Road is around ₹20,000 per sq.ft carpet area (as of mid-2026). An indicative transaction benchmark is around ₹16,500 per sq.ft, and the government Ready Reckoner rate (built-up area) is estimated near ₹12,000 per sq.ft.

What is the price range for a flat in Kolshet Road?

Based on current market listings, a 1 BHK in Kolshet Road runs roughly ₹70 Lakh – ₹1.15 Cr, a 2 BHK ₹1.25 – 2.10 Cr, and a 3 BHK ₹2.20 – 3.60 Cr.

Is Kolshet Road a good rental investment?

Gross rental yield in Kolshet Road is around 3.2%. As with any single area, actual returns depend on the specific building, possession stage and timing.
